Ethereum Activates 'Dencun' Upgrade, in Landmark Move to Reduce Data Fees
13.3.2024
A key element of the upgrade is to enable a new place for storing data on the blockchain – referred to as "proto-danksharding," which gives room for a dedicated space that is separate from regular transactions, and at a lower cost

What Are Zero-Knowledge Proofs?
11.1.2024
Zero-knowledge proofs (ZKPs) allow crypto network users to verify the validity of a transaction without revealing details of the transaction
